The Lakeland Joint School District policy committee reviewed edits to the student dress policy including specifications for shorts, skirt length and enforcement, and agreed to return the draft to the author and the full board before public distribution.

The Lakeland Joint School District policy committee reviewed proposed edits to the district's student dress code and agreed not to finalize changes midyear.

Committee members discussed specific language about permitted clothing and enforcement, including phrases describing coverage of undergarments, skirt and short lengths ("mid-thigh"), and rules around head coverings during ceremonies. Trustee Rusty had submitted a draft with changes; committee staff said the draft should be returned to Rusty for review and then presented to the full board before any parent survey or broader outreach.
